During VR development, we found that Planar reflection appears to be double layered in HMD.

On the rendering screen, it can be seen as a single layer, but only in HMD, it can be seen as a double layer.

image.thumb.png.1b19c2c4a48002f4bce63d6b7e5bd907.png

It's a rendering screen. As you can see, the window is well reflected by plane reflection.

However, when viewed in VR using HMD, other objects are well rendered in one layer, but only the reflective screen reflected on the window comes out in two layers.

We thought this phenomenon was a problem in HMD, so we brought a lot of HMDs and implemented them.

The HMD I ran was Varjo VR2, Varjo VR3, Varjo XR3, VIVE Cosmos, Oculus question 1, and only the reflected screens in all HMDs were double-layered.
